Starting a small business, especially in a town like Athens that is teeming with competition, is no easy feat. For Cakewalk, a bake shop opened on South Milledge Avenue just three months ago, the town's thriving community atmosphere has instead been a means for success.
Cakewalk boasts a wide array of baked goods and unique gifts, from cakes and cookies to jewelry and vintage items. The baked goods are not made in-house but are instead sourced from local—or in some cases just outside of Athens—bakeries.
For owner Jennifer Mitchell, opening the business at its current location was entirely intentional as it allowed for a connection into a diverse, and lively, segment of the Athens population.
"Milledge is wonderful. It has a mixture of everyone—it has college students, it has businesses, and it has restaurants. It's unique with the antebellum homes," said Mitchell, "and there's so much pedestrian traffic with people out walking dogs and their kids."
This nearly constant foot traffic on South Milledge has brought a steady stream of customers into Mitchell's shop. On any given day, college students and business people alike can be seen stopping in for a tasty treat. Further, word-of-mouth in the closely connected Athens community has also been a helpful force.
"Business has been wonderful. We've been open almost three months and our name, I didn’t realize, is being passed around so much in a good way," said Mitchell. "They'll say, 'Oh I heard about you on the radio,' or 'I read about you in the Red & Black'... People are spreading the word around, which is nice."
For Mitchell, this success of Cakewalk has carried a much greater importance than just financial, as it has meant finding a home in the Athens community.
"I have been around the world. I've lived in different places. The welcome feeling that has been extended to me by Athens is unlike any place I've ever been," said Mitchell. "It is just the most wonderful feeling to be surrounded by other businesses that welcome you with open arms and my customers are the same exact way. They come in, they make me laugh, we have coffee together... I can't imagine doing this any place other than Athens."
